Changes between Version 18 and Version 19 of barSoftwareErrorCorrection
- Timestamp:
- 10/26/11 08:16:37 (13 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
barSoftwareErrorCorrection
v18 v19 14 14 15 15 16 [[Image(006__final_comparison.png)]] 16 [[Image(006__final_comparison.png)]] FIGURE 1 17 17 18 18 ---- … … 49 49 50 50 A problem we encountered during tracing was the lack of labels 51 attributed to some areas. 3dBAR vector parser automatically detects 52 such unlabeled regions by comparing the sum of traced paths with the 53 total area of the ''Brain'' structure. The parser locates all 51 attributed to some areas. This can happen when "obvious" names are 52 omitted in commercial atlases; when user does not recognize the area in histological slice (see example in figure 5), but also when additional area is erroneously defined by accidental line crossing (see figure 2 below). 53 54 3dBAR vector parser automatically detects such unlabeled regions by comparing the sum of traced paths with the total area of the ''Brain'' structure. The parser locates all 54 55 contiguous unlabelled regions consisting of more than a given number 55 56 of pixels and traces them. The resulting structures are called 56 57 ''Unlabelled'' and may be indexed and reconstructed similarly to 57 58 the regular structures. 58 59 59 60 60 Left: Red blocks mark regions where irregular neighboring lines touch each other creating small closed areas. … … 65 65 66 66 67 [[Image(001__unlabelled_annotated.gif)]] 67 [[Image(001__unlabelled_annotated.gif)]]FIGURE 2 68 68 69 === Displaced labels === 69 === Incorrect label placement === 70 71 Error correction procedure also looks for labels displaced outside the brain outline or labels anchored directly above contours. 72 73 The latter may happen when a structure is defined as a thin 74 strip between other structures. Since tracing contours themselves is not allowed, such incidents are recorded and a thumbnail image is generated allowing user to examine 75 and correct the error. 76 77 Tracing of a region corresponding to the incorrectly placed label is skipped but in general tracing is not interrupted as the whole procedure works non-interactively. 70 78 71 79 Left: … … 73 81 Right: 74 82 75 [[Image(003__invalid_labels_annotated.gif)]] 83 [[Image(003__invalid_labels_annotated.gif)]]FIGURE 3 76 84 77 85 … … 89 97 about ambiguous delineation and should review the slide in question 90 98 and correct it. 91 92 === Labels placed over contours ===93 94 Error correction procedure also looks for labels anchored directly95 above contours which may happen when a structure is defined as a thin96 strip between other structures or placed outside the brain outline. Since97 tracing contours themselves is not allowed, such incidents are98 recorded and a thumbnail image is generated allowing user to examine99 and correct the error. Tracing of a region corresponding to the100 particular label is skipped but in general tracing is not interrupted101 as the whole procedure works non-interactively.102 103 99 104 100 ---- … … 128 124 Right: 129 125 130 [[Image(002__gapfill_annotated.gif)]] 126 [[Image(002__gapfill_annotated.gif)]]FIGURE 4 131 127 132 128 ---- … … 146 142 Right: Updated CAF slide. 147 143 148 [[Image(0041_new_edges_animated.gif)]] 144 [[Image(0041_new_edges_animated.gif)]]FIGURE 5 149 145 150 146 ---- … … 157 153 Right: 158 154 159 [[Image(007__final_electrode.png)]] 155 [[Image(007__final_electrode.png)]]FIGURE 6 160 156 161 157 == List of used abbreviations ==